        pybox2d - A 2D rigid body simulation library for Python
        
        
        - Description:
- Programmer's can use Box2D in their games to make objects move in
believable ways and make the world seem more interactive. From the
game's point of view a physics engine is just a system for procedural
animation. Rather than paying (or begging) an animator to move your
actors around, you can let Sir Isaac Newton do the directing.
